350 Block identification

Just wondering....I just bought a beater truck and it has a "201" 350 block. What does this number signify. It is in the same place that most blocks have "010"

My "Chevrolet Small-Block V-8 Interchange Manual" says casting number 14010201 is a 1985-1986 305 (three-o-five).

Casting numbers don't mean much since the same casting can be used for many years on many different models. Specific castings such as the 010 are more desirable for their strength and metal alloy content. The 010 blocks have a high nickle alloy in them.

I also see the 201 casting as a 305 block but my listing have it from 80-84 in cars and trucks.
